Dadirri | Noun | Australian Aboriginal |

“A deep, spiritual act of reflection and respectful listening or communion with life.”

Reflection does not always arrive easily or without some level of resistance. Nonetheless, in order to commune with that which is life, it necessitates honoring it’s inherent duality; the challenging and the easy flow, the warmth and the bitter-cold, the sorrow and the deep joy. Respecting and actively accepting all the ways we are shown what needs to be seen.

It is an ongoing and ever-evolving practice to live in a state of Dadirri.
